What are Glass-Fused-to-Steel Tanks?
Glass-Fused-to-Steel Tanks (GFS) are a cutting-edge technology that combines the strength of steel with the superior corrosion resistance of glass. The glass is fused to the steel at extremely high temperatures, creating an impermeable, smooth surface that prevents corrosion and deterioration from harsh environmental factors. This unique construction process results in tanks that can withstand extreme conditions while ensuring safe and efficient storage of various liquids, including potable water, wastewater, sewage, biogas, and chemicals.

Key Advantages of Glass-Fused-to-Steel Tanks
1. Unmatched Corrosion Resistance
Corrosion is a major concern for traditional storage tanks, particularly in industries dealing with water, sewage, and chemicals. Glass-Fused-to-Steel tanks eliminate this risk. The glass lining creates an inert surface that resists rust, decay, and chemical damage, even when exposed to aggressive environments such as industrial effluents or sewage. This makes GFS tanks ideal for both municipal water storage and industrial applications, ensuring long-term performance with minimal maintenance.
2. Durability and Longevity
GFS tanks are built to last. Unlike other storage solutions, which may degrade over time due to external factors, Glass-Fused-to-Steel tanks offer exceptional durability, even under harsh conditions. These tanks are resistant to temperature fluctuations, extreme pressure, and physical wear, making them a reliable solution for long-term storage needs. Whether used for drinking water, wastewater storage, or fire water storage, GFS tanks offer a service life of decades, making them a cost-effective investment for businesses and municipalities alike.
3. Modular and Flexible Design
One of the major advantages of GFS tanks is their modular design. Unlike welded tanks, which require extensive construction time and resources, GFS tanks are built using bolted panels that can be assembled quickly on-site. This allows for customized sizing to meet specific storage requirements, making them suitable for a wide range of applications, from small-scale agricultural projects to large municipal water systems.
Furthermore, GFS tanks are easily expandable, which means they can grow with your needs. As demands increase, additional panels can be added to extend the capacity without the need for a full redesign.
4. Eco-Friendly and Sustainable
Sustainability is becoming an increasingly important factor in choosing storage solutions. Glass-Fused-to-Steel tanks are environmentally friendly, offering a non-toxic and sustainable storage option. The glass coating ensures that no harmful chemicals leach into the stored contents, making them suitable for storing potable water and agricultural liquids. Additionally, GFS tanks are 100% recyclable, further enhancing their eco-friendly appeal.
5. Low Maintenance and High Efficiency
Glass-Fused-to-Steel tanks require minimal maintenance compared to other types of storage tanks. The glass lining prevents the growth of bacteria and algae, while the smooth surface makes cleaning and maintenance easier. With long-lasting performance and minimal upkeep, these tanks ensure a reliable and efficient storage solution for water and liquid management.
Applications of Glass-Fused-to-Steel Tanks
1. Potable Water Storage
For drinking water storage, GFS tanks are widely recognized for their safety, efficiency, and long-term performance. The corrosion-resistant glass coating ensures that the water remains clean, fresh, and free from contamination, making GFS tanks ideal for municipal water systems and remote agricultural projects. Whether it’s for large-scale city water systems or off-grid farm irrigation, GFS tanks provide an economical and sustainable solution.
2. Wastewater and Sewage Treatment
In wastewater treatment and sewage management systems, GFS tanks provide a safe and reliable solution for storing treated wastewater or sludge. The impervious glass lining prevents the degradation caused by highly corrosive chemicals in wastewater, ensuring long-term tank integrity and reducing the risk of contamination. Additionally, the tanks can withstand the harsh environmental conditions typical in industrial effluent treatment plants, offering low-maintenance, cost-effective storage for sewage and wastewater.
3. Biogas Storage
Biogas production is becoming increasingly important in sustainable energy solutions, and GFS tanks are well-suited to store this renewable energy source. The glass coating protects the tank from the corrosive effects of biogas while ensuring that the gas remains safely contained until it is ready for use. GFS tanks are commonly used in biogas plants, landfill operations, and agricultural waste treatment facilities, where they store biogas generated during anaerobic digestion processes.
4. Agricultural Liquid Storage
Agriculture requires large-scale storage solutions for various liquids, including irrigation water, fertilizers, and pesticides. GFS tanks are the ideal solution for farmers who need durable and safe storage for agricultural liquids. The glass lining ensures the stored liquid remains uncontaminated and stable, while the modular design allows for easy scaling based on farm size and crop needs. GFS tanks help maintain the integrity of the stored liquids, allowing for efficient irrigation and fertilizer management.
5. Fire Water Storage
For emergency fire water storage, GFS tanks provide a robust and reliable solution. These tanks are designed to store large quantities of water that can be used in case of fire emergencies. The corrosion resistance ensures that the stored water remains clean and uncontaminated, even if the tank is exposed to extreme weather or environmental conditions.
